Abstract EN
A wavelet method is proposed to evaluate the modeling of the first- and second-order statistics of large-scale fading from the signal strength measurement.
The selection of wavelet is very important in using a wavelet method, and the steps of the wavelet method are given for the study of wave propagation loss.
The path loss of measurement is analysed with different levels of wavelet decomposition and compared with an optimized Hata model.
The correlation of slow fading on different scales shows that the correlation distance is related to the spatial scale.
